Output e544336be8651f72ab0b25d06ba060264cc92a68ad413d3eee2ec20e18e6a383:10

value
10088009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b6295eb8ca1e19716f9ca6510cb5a2dc890522f OP_EQUAL
address
34BpGaACdRqnxGBy6rqcwgAtzTDEjRvHtS
transaction
e544336be8651f72ab0b25d06ba060264cc92a68ad413d3eee2ec20e18e6a383
confirmations
290988
spent
true